Ice cream has developed its own fan base as a delicacy. In both happy and sad times, ice creams of various flavours play a significant role in elevating the atmosphere. Although new ice cream brands and flavours are introduced periodically, ice cream has existed for centuries. In the fourth century B.C., the Roman emperor Nero ordered ice from the mountains and combined it with fruit garnishes, creating a dish similar to ice cream. Due to the lack of freezers at the time, there was no other means to obtain ice. During the years 618–97 A.D., King Tang of China created a method for preparing ice and milk concoctions. M. Emy of France published a collection of frozen dessert recipes in 1768. However, the first advertisement for ice cream did not appear until 1774. Following this time, ice creams began to acquire popularity.
Peach ice cream, like other ice cream flavours, has an intriguing history behind its invention. A French chef named Auguste Escoffier invented a novel dessert for a dinner party. The dessert was a swan-shaped ice sculpture that rested on vanilla ice cream and was crowned with peaches and sugar. In the year 1900, the chef devised a new dessert featuring peaches with raspberry puree. This combination of flavours and ingredients lead to the development of peach ice cream.
